AndroidManifest硬件加速实现流程

本文将介绍如何在AndroidManifest文件中实现硬件加速。硬件加速可以提高应用程序的图形渲染性能,使应用在运行时更加流畅。下面是实现硬件加速的流程:

flowchart TD
A(创建一个新的Android项目)
B(打开AndroidManifest.xml文件)
C(在<application>标签中添加属性android:hardwareAccelerated="true")
D(保存并关闭AndroidManifest.xml文件)
E(编译并运行应用程序)

步骤详解

1. 创建一个新的Android项目

首先,我们需要创建一个新的Android项目。使用Android Studio或其它IDE创建一个新的空白项目,并确保项目结构正确。

2. 打开AndroidManifest.xml文件

接下来,我们需要打开AndroidManifest.xml文件,该文件位于项目的根目录下的app/src/main目录中。

3. 在<application>标签中添加属性android:hardwareAccelerated="true"

在AndroidManifest.xml文件中,找到<application>标签,并在该标签中添加属性android:hardwareAccelerated="true"。这个属性告诉系统启用硬件加速。

<application
    android:hardwareAccelerated="true"
    ...>
    ...
</application>

4. 保存并关闭AndroidManifest.xml文件

保存并关闭AndroidManifest.xml文件。

5. 编译并运行应用程序

编译并运行应用程序,确保硬件加速已经生效。在应用程序运行时,图形渲染将会使用硬件加速,提高渲染性能。

代码示例

AndroidManifest.xml配置

在AndroidManifest.xml文件的<application>标签中,添加属性android:hardwareAccelerated="true",如下所示:

<application
    android:hardwareAccelerated="true"
    ...>
    ...
</application>

这样,应用程序将启用硬件加速。

序列图

下面是一个序列图,展示了硬件加速的实现流程:

sequenceDiagram
    participant 开发者
    participant 小白

    开发者 ->> 小白: 告诉他硬件加速的流程
    开发者 ->> 小白: 指导他打开AndroidManifest.xml文件
    Note right of 小白: 打开AndroidManifest.xml文件
    开发者 ->> 小白: 指导他在<application>标签中添加属性
    Note right of 小白: 在<application>标签中添加属性
    开发者 ->> 小白: 指导他保存并关闭AndroidManifest.xml文件
    Note right of 小白: 保存并关闭AndroidManifest.xml文件
    开发者 ->> 小白: 指导他编译并运行应用程序
    Note right of 小白: 编译并运行应用程序

以上的序列图展示了开发者和小白之间的交互过程,以及每个步骤的详细指导。

希望本文对你有所帮助,祝你学习进步!